We're sorry but Naavi doesn't work properly without JavaScript enabled. Please enable it to continue.
St Gabriel's School Newsletter
Specialist
Specialist
Engaging With Place Recipes
Learning & Teaching
Maths, Literacy
Family Engagement Group
Family Engagement Catch Up
Specialist